RE: The tariff classification of a wireless headset from Mexico.

Dear Mr. Phalen:

In your letter dated December 24, 2003 you requested a tariff classification ruling.

The item in question is a wireless headset denoted as the M3000 Bluetooth headset. The device performs the same function as that model denoted in NY Ruling G86645. This device is designed to interact with a cellular telephone in a completely wireless mode. It is configured with Bluetooth technology with its wireless capability furnished by the incorporated Bluetooth element.

The only difference in function is that this particular model provides more talking time and is of a lighter weight.

The applicable subheading for the wireless headset model M3000 will be 8525.20.9080, Harmonized Tariff Schedule of the United States (HTS), which provides for Transmission apparatus for radiotelephony, radiotelegraphy, radiobroadcasting or television, whether or not incorporating reception apparatus or sound recording or reproducing apparatus; television cameras; still image video cameras and other video camera recorders; digital cameras: Other Other. The rate of duty will be free.
